DESCRIPTION:Friday\, November 18: \nMele at the Moana Featuring Raiatea Helm. Raiatea Helm burst into the music scene in Hawaii as a teenager\, and her virtuoso recordings and performances launched her onto the international music scene. In 2006\, she became the first female recording artist from Hawai`i to be nominated for a Grammy Award for her second CD\, “Sweet and Lovely.” Moana Surfrider\, A Westin Resort & Spa\, under the banyan tree\, 2364 Kalakaua\, Honolulu. Music begins at 5:30 p.m.\, with the featured performer taking the stage from 7 to 9 p.m. For information call (808) 271-9176 or visit www.moana-surfrider.com.

DESCRIPTION:Friday\, November 18:\nNahko & Medicine for the People.  Nahko is an Oregon native born\, a mix of Puerto Rican\, Native American\, and Filipino bloodlines. Disillusioned by the world around him and inspired by vagabond\, Americana musicians and storytellers like Conor Oberst and Bob Dylan\, Nahko left home as a teenager in search of adventure and self-discovery.  Nahko describes his music as a mix of hip hop and folk rock with a world message.  Maui Arts & Cultural Center\, Yokouchi Pavilion & Courtyard\, One Cameron Way\, Kahului.  7:30 p.m.\, gates open at 6 p.m.  For tickets and information call (808) 242-7469 or visit www.mauiarts.org.
